Analysis
In 2024, locust beans (carobs) — gross per capita production index number in Tunisia stood at 88.76.
The figure is down 1.1% on the previous year and down 13.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, locust beans (carobs) — gross per capita production index number in Tunisia peaked at 170.38 in 1992 and was at its lowest, 6.91, in 1975.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 50 years of available data.

About this data
The FAO indices of agricultural production show the relative level of the aggregate volume of agricultural production for each year in comparison with the base period 2014-2016. Indices for meat production are computed based on data on production from indigenous animals.
